The Shelfwright catalogue importer accepts MARC-style and CSV source files and maps them onto the Shelfwright record schema. Plugin authors extending the importer should validate field mappings against the schema reference before filing issues; most reported bugs turn out to be mapping mismatches rather than importer defects. When reporting a problem, include the importer version, a minimal sample file with any patron data removed, and the full error output. Questions and bug reports for the import pipeline go to the integrations team.

escalation mailbox, bafog-fafog: ulador@paliqlabs.internal

Subject: Key rotation for Stonemill incremental builds

Hi Devan,

We're rotating the credential used by Stonemill, the internal service that triggers incremental static site rebuilds when content changes merge. The current key expires Thursday at noon. Since you're reviewing the build-pipeline PR, please confirm the new credential is referenced in the updated config rather than hardcoded, and that only changed pages rebuild in the test run. The replacement key for Stonemill is below.

service key, fawip-bajef: kto11_Qt5wZK9vdNC

## Runbook: Cold Bucket Archival (Frostvault)

Owner rotates weekly; confirm ownership in the sync notes before running. Archival moves any bucket untouched for 180 days from warm tier to Frostvault glacier class. Run the dry-run first and paste the candidate list into the sync channel for sign-off. Throttle to 50 buckets per batch to avoid saturating the transfer gateway. Progress and resumable checkpoints are tracked in the archival ledger database, reachable via the connection string below.

replica DSN, kajep-yahag: mssql://praok_svc:iF@db-8d68.plorvaio.local:5432/eliion